Why Choose Portland for Your Retreat?
Portland is an ideal retreat destination due to its unique blend of urban and natural environments. With a mild climate, beautiful parks, and rich local culture, it offers a refreshing backdrop for team bonding and strategic planning. The best seasons for a retreat are spring and fall, where you can enjoy pleasant weather and fewer tourists.
Getting There
Portland International Airport (PDX) is just 12 minutes from downtown, making it easy for your team to arrive. Most major airlines operate here, and you can expect competitive fares.

Timeline for Planning Your Retreat
Here's a week-by-week timeline to help you stay on track:
4 Weeks Out
- Finalize Goals: Define objectives for the retreat.
- Select Venue: Choose from the list above and book immediately.
- Budget Planning: Determine overall budget based on venue costs.
3 Weeks Out
- Send Invitations: Notify team members and gather RSVPs.
- Plan Agenda: Outline key sessions, breaks, and activities.
2 Weeks Out
- Confirm Catering: Arrange meals and snacks (consider local catering services).
- Finalize Activities: Book any offsite excursions or team-building activities.
1 Week Out
- Check Logistics: Confirm AV equipment, room setups, and transportation.
- Prepare Materials: Print any necessary documents or presentations.
Day Before
- Setup: Arrive early to ensure everything is in place.
- Welcome Kits: Prepare any materials for attendees.

Risk Mitigation: What Could Go Wrong?
- Venue Availability: Always have a backup venue in mind.
- Weather Conditions: Plan for indoor alternatives if you plan outdoor activities.
- Catering Issues: Confirm arrangements one week prior and have a backup caterer.
